Joao Quiñónez is a 27-year-old football player who plays as a center back for CDT Real Oruro, born on 15 Mei 1999. Follow Joao Quiñónez on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.

In the 2026 Primera División season, Joao Quiñónez has recorded 0 goals, 0 assists, 243 minutes, an average FotMob rating of 5.86, 1 yellow card.

Joao Quiñónez's career has also included time at Emelec, Libertad, CSD Macara, Nueve de Octubre, Deportivo Cuenca, Universidad Catolica, and Tecnico Universitario.

On the international stage, Joao Quiñónez has represented Ecuador Under 22 and Ecuador U20.

Throughout their career, Joao Quiñónez has won 1 title: CONMEBOL U20 Championship (2019 Chile) with Ecuador U20.
